**Action item (INC follow-up): Varrow Assign service**

Sticky assignments expired early during the outage, so some users flipped experiment arms mid-session. Support: if customers report inconsistent features, check assignment timestamps before escalating. Fix shipped; TTLs and cache bounds were retuned to prevent recurrence. Do not manually reassign users. Escalate only if flips persist past the new TTL window. Revised constants are listed below.

tuning table, yaweg-kajef:
WEIGHTS = {
    "ralwyn": 573,
    "praius": 56,
    "eliok": 19,
}

Handover: Perrow → Vask

Partner SFTP drop for Calderline feeds is stable. Friday upload ran clean. One open item: the drop account rotated last week, so the old credentials are dead. Release manager needs the recovery passphrase to re-provision access before next cycle. It follows here.

unlock words, bagag-kajef: zormir-jorath-tammir-oliius-briix-norys

## 4.2.0 — Setting renamed

Following the stale-cache postmortem for Corvid Cache, `CACHE_TTL` is renamed to `CACHE_TTL_SECONDS` to remove unit ambiguity; the old name was being read as milliseconds by some plugins. Both names work until 5.0, with the new one taking precedence. Plugin authors should update their sample `.env` files, adding the cache signing credential on the next line.

secret setting of hawep-yahig: LEDGER_TOKEN29=41b5d6315371c92885eaeb077fb63

Handover: DeployPing bot, from Anika to Torvald. The bot posts deploy status to team channels via the Hearthline gateway. It holds a read-only token scoped to pipeline events; no write access anywhere. Rotation is quarterly, last done two weeks ago. For the security review, the threat model and scope notes are on the internal page below.

runbook for badug-kadup: https://confluence.zemvarlabs.internal/projects/browse/display/projects/bd1b